Hubbard Construction is Hiring a Skilled Laborer Near Lakeland, FL

100 Years of Experience at Work for You!
Since 1920, the professional men and women of Hubbard Construction have literally paved the way for hundreds of public and private projects that have supported Florida's rise to prominence.
Hubbard is one of Florida's largest heavy civil construction companies. We are proud to be a part of Florida's history and we are eager to continue to serve the Florida market and beyond.
The scope of Hubbard's work includes complex highway projects, site development, paving, utility and drainage systems, surveying, RAP and hot mix sales, and state-of-the-art bridge building. We provide multiple delivery systems in design-build, bid-build, public/private-partnerships and design-build finance.
Hubbard Construction's parent company, Eurovia, operates through a network of 330 agencies and 770 production sites, in 17 countries around the world.

General Description

A skilled laborer is an hourly-rated skilled craft position that performs intermediate semi-skilled work in connection with heavy, civil construction projects involving roads, bridges and highways. Will assist construction and/or paving crew with various duties including, but not limited to: shoveling and raking, running wheelbarrow, operating small power tools such as jackhammer and assists in the placement, moving, and dismantling of signs, barricades, cones and other traffic devices, Will perform other duties as assigned.

Key Duties

  • Requires little independent judgment.
  • Measures distance from grade stakes, drives stakes, and stretches tight line.
  • Bolts, nails, aligns, and block up under forms.
  • Signals operators of construction or asphalt equipment to facilitate alignment, movement, and adjustment of machinery to conform to grade specifications.
  • Level earth or asphalt to grade specifications, using picks, shovels and rakes.
  • Mixes concrete and applies caulking compounds.
  • Variety of tasks involving dexterous use of hands and tools, such as sawing lumber, dismantling forms, removing projections from concrete, and mounting pipe hangers.
  • Perform incidental work items and duties included within other crafts.

Qualification Requirements

  • General. To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each Key Du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
  • Education and Experience. This position typically is not an entry-level job, as it requires demonstrable previous experience as a Semi Skilled Laborer. A high school diploma or general education degree (GED) is preferred. Must be able to understand work directions and communicate effectively with job site supervisors and fellow employees. One (1) year or more of industry related experience is required for this position, with an emphasis on roads, highways, and bridges.
  • Physical Demands. The following physical demands are representative of those that must be met by a Semi Skilled Laborer to successfully perform the essential functions of this job.
    • Constant physical effort, including standing, is required during a regular work shift of at least eight hours per day. Employee must be able to stand for extended periods of time, and to stoop, bend, and crouch as required to perform Key Duties.
    • Frequently work with hands extended overhead, sometimes in conjunction with the operation of hand power tools.
    • Ability to lift and carry, on a frequent basis, at least 50-90 pounds personally, and up to 150 pounds with assistance.
    • Manual dexterity to hand-carry generators, lumber and other construction materials, forms, power tools, and hand tools.
    • Capable of operating concrete vibrators for extended periods of time.
    • Maintain constant alertness to the multiple concurrent activities of the construction site, including the activities of other employees and contractors, the operation of stationary equipment, and the movement of mobile equipment.
    • Frequently walk on uneven surfaces, including natural ground in varying weather conditions.
  • Work Environment. The work environment characteristics described below are representative of those that a Semi Skilled Laborer encounters while performing the essential functions of this job.
    • Work is performed outdoors in all weather conditions.
    • Work environment periodically exposes the employees to high levels of noise, grease, and dust that is typically associated with a construction project.
    • Employee regularly works near heavy equipment and moving machinery.
    • Work may involve a variety of substances commonly found on construction sites such as form oil, grease, curing compounds, gasoline, diesel fuel and ready mixed concrete.
    • The ability to hear, understand, and distinguish speech and/or other sounds (e.g., moving equipment, backing alarms, or other alarms, instructions/directions from supervisor and/or spotter).
